EU budget 2027: Commission proposes €12.8bn for Horizon Europe and €4.5bn for Erasmus+

The European Commission published its estimates for funding needs for 2027 on 10/06/2026, proposing €12.838 billion for Horizon Europe, a total of €13.806bn for research & innovation, as well as €4.511bn for Erasmus+. The draft 2027 budget for Horizon Europe amounts to €12.839 billion, €155…
